Steve Sloan, San Jose, CA: Walk by the ponds
Steve Sloan, San Jose, CA: Walk by the ponds
Steve Sloan, San Jose, CA: Walk by the ponds
Steve Sloan, San Jose, CA: Noon Davis Manifest
Steve Sloan, San Jose, CA: Train 724 in Davis
Steve Sloan, San Jose, CA: Train 536 in Davis
Steve Sloan, San Jose, CA: Train 536 in Davis
Steve Sloan, San Jose, CA: Train 536 in Davis